#5e5a68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e5a68 is composed of 36.9% red, 35.3%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.6% cyan, 13.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 257.1 degrees, a saturation of 7.2% and a lightness of 38%. #5e5a68 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cb4d0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#5e5a68 color description : Very dark grayish violet.
#5e5a68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5e5a68 has RGB values of R:94, G:90,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6183528.
